For those of you who don't know, Davao City proper is just minutes away from the gorgeous Samal Island. You just have to ride a barge or boat to get to the destination, usually barge is very accessible to everyone. You can go to Samal via barge anytime you want! It's very convenient to every tourist/s who wants to escape the hustle and bustle life in the city - even to our part as locals, if we have spare time and longer weekends, we always head to the beach to unwind. Speaking of the beach, we went to this beautiful resort called Villa Amparo. It's located at Sitio Dasag, Barangay Camudmud, Island Garden City of Samal. From Samal wharf, it's a 30-45 minute drive via motorcycle, private vehicle/s or you may avail their shuttle. Kadayawan Festival, one of the most celebrated festivals in the country. It commemorates the town's thanksgiving for a bountiful harvest and blessings to each town's and tribes. It's celebrated yearly during August usually held on the second week. It's been an honor to participate at this event. Gladly, our school also performed during the Indak-Indak sa Kadalanan. It is participated in numbers of categories consists of participants in different schools, places, etc. Despite of the security measurements that was implemented during the whole event, locals and tourists didn't hesitate to go out, explore and enjoy what Davao City offers!
